F1, Feature, IndyCar, Opinion
McLaren Racing’s Daniel Ricciardo has confirmed that he won’t compete in Formula One next season and is focusing on a return to the sport in 2024 however, the Australian could potentially fins a new home in the United States. When McLaren Racing acquired a...